The Frio Trail Runs, held at Garner State Park in Concan, Texas, is a challenging trail running event featuring distances from 5K to 50K, including a 10K RUCK. The course consists of rocky, dirt-packed single-track trails with significant elevation gains—about 1,400 to 1,550 feet per 6-mile loop—highlighted by a climb up Old Baldy Mountain, offering stunning summit views. The race tests endurance and strength across hilly terrain with scenic vistas throughout the park. Participants receive race gear, finisher medals, and enjoy aid stations, a fully marked course, and supportive staff, making it a rewarding outdoor adventure for trail runners.
